What Will You Do 

The E2E Supply Planning Leader is accountable for the result and the proper process execution of all the supply planning processes and is owner of the inventory and service results across the value stream. This role is responsible for orchestrating the design and execution of the supply chain across different Supply Chain functions including make, source, deliver and finance.

The E2E Supply Planning Leader is responsible in conjunction with Demand/IBP leader the supply-demand balancing.

Key Responsibilities:

E2E Supply Planning

  • Drive robust process and drumbeats to ensure supply chain synchronization across the supply planning processes:

    • Long Term Capacity Planning (LTCP), Rough Cut Capacity Planning (RCCP), Master Production Scheduling (MPS), Material Supply Management (MSM), Materials Requirement Planning (MRP), Detailed Scheduling (DS), Distribution Planning DRP)

  • Owns and drives regional Segment Supply Review and Supply Point Reviews. Owns supply allocation decisions and escalation actions to the next IBP forums. 

  • Orchestrates E2E trade-off decision. Partner and play the role of gatekeeper with supply chain partners to have the most realistic Supply information available as input to IBP Process to balance service, inventory and costs.

  • Own inventory management policies for respective segments/ franchises, ensuring the right balance between service, cost, and inventory within the network. Responsibilities include meeting inventory targets, optimizing supply chain efficiency, handling SLOB, track optimization projects, inventory reporting and projection.

  • Accountable for master data accuracy. Develops and implements planning rules, standards, and process to support the overall planning agenda.

  • Supports New Product Initiatives & Product Changeovers by ensuring on time supply availability for launch and minimizing inventory write-offs.
